判断对错,先给出判断:视图中保存的仅仅是一条select语句,而非数据
时间: 2024-02-26 16:54:26 浏览: 137
部分正确。
在 MySQL 中,视图是虚拟的表,其内容由查询定义。视图中保存的是一条 `SELECT` 语句,而不是实际的数据。当查询视图时,MySQL 实际上会执行视图中定义的 `SELECT` 语句,然后返回结果集。因此,视图中保存的是查询的元数据而不是数据本身。
需要注意的是,虽然视图中保存的是查询的元数据,但在某些情况下,MySQL 可能会将视图的结果集缓存到临时表中以提高性能。例如,如果多个查询使用相同的视图,MySQL 可能会缓存视图的结果集,以避免重复计算。
此外,视图还可以用于隐藏复杂的查询逻辑和简化查询语句。通过使用视图,可以将复杂的查询逻辑封装在视图中,并在需要时直接查询视图,而不必担心查询的复杂性。
因此,视图中保存的是一条 `SELECT` 语句,而不是实际的数据,但在某些情况下,MySQL 可能会将视图的结果集缓存到临时表中以提高性能。
阅读全文